: You can download a full disk image (ISO) for multi-edition installations directly from Microsoft's Software Download site. Troubleshooting Download Issues
If you are looking for this specific build or a general Windows 11 installation file, Microsoft provides several official routes:
: Avoid downloading "Ultralight" or modified ISOs from unofficial third-party websites (like forums or file-sharing sites). These versions are often stripped of essential security features and may contain malware. Always stick to official Microsoft sources for OS files.
: Microsoft often blocks download requests from anonymous network paths.
: To get build 22621.590, enroll your device in the Beta Channel via Settings > Update & Security > Windows Insider Program . Once enrolled, check for updates to download the build directly.